Facilities Ticket — Cleaning Crew Access, Brindle Annex

For new starters handling evening lock-up: the Sorano Cleaning crew arrives nightly at 21:30 via the annex side door. Check their rota sheet, note arrival in the log, and ensure the storeroom is relocked afterward. To let them through the side door, enter the access code below.

badge for yaweg-hafog: bdg-GX-6

## Wavelet Preview Environments

The waveform preview in Soundcrate is rendered by the `wavelet-preview` worker, which downsamples uploads into peak files before the player loads. Heads up: staging and prod use different peak resolutions, so don't panic if previews look chunkier on staging — that's intentional to save disk. The renderer picks its environment from the deploy manifest, not from env vars, which has bitten at least two maintainers so far. Current per-environment settings are below.

config for tawif-bagef:
[sorwyn]
team = sorys
access_code = ac_9ba40c
host = sorwyn.ordingrid.local
port = 5000
owner = aldok.quenion
peer = belath.paliqcloud.local

Ticket: ProctorFlow vault sealed — exam queue stalled

Heads up: the Keephatch vault that holds signing keys for the ProctorFlow exam-proctoring queue sealed itself during last night's host reboot. Result: new proctoring sessions are stuck in pending and students can't start timed exams. Restarting workers won't help until the vault is unsealed. You're on-call, so this one's yours — grab the unseal console from the Wardenrail admin box and enter the recovery passphrase below.

vault phrase of bagaf-kajeg = jorath-feniel-briir-siliel-ralix